After the time change on Saturday, the Baan worktop thinks the time is one hour earlier then it really is. The application server shows the right time. Is there a way of adjusting the time in the worktop?

For example: when running a job, it shows the job kicking off at 5:30 PM but it's really 6:30 PM on the application server.

Previously I m facing same problem. As I guess, you are runing this job on daily basis. In session ttaad5100s000, in Period instead of 1 day, enter period as 24 Hrs.

If you enter 1 day, my experiance is, 1st time job executes at 5.30 pm and finish at 6.30 pm. From next day, it executes at 6.30 pm. Where as if you enter period as 5.30 pm, daily basis it will execute at 5.30 pm only. Nothing to do with GMT timing here.
